Course layout

UNIT 1:

Review of Networking Basics; Advance Topics in IPv4 – Subnetting, Multicasting, Multicast Routing

Protocols (IGMP, PIM, DVMRP); Advance Topics in TCP – flow management, congestion avoidance,

protocol spoofing; IPv6

UNIT 2:

Network Redundancy, Load Balancers, Caching, Storage Networks; QoS; Network Monitoring – SNMP, RMON.

UNIT 3:

Introduction to Network Security – VLAN, VPN, Firewall, IPS, Proxy Servers

UNIT 4:

Telecom Networks, Switching Techniques; Introduction to Frame Relay, ATM, MPLS.

VSAT Communication – Star and Mesh architectures, bandwidth reservation.

Wireless Networks – WiFi, WiMax, Cellular Phone Technologies – GSM, CDMA, 3G, 4G

UNIT 5:

Network Simulation, Network design case studies and exercises, IP Addressing schema, Protocol

Analyzers (Wireshark, etc)

Books and references

1. RFCs and Standards Documents (www.ietf.org and other standard body websites)

2. Communication Networking – An Analytical Approach, Anurag-Manjunath-Joy

3. TCP/IP Illustrated (Vol.1,2), Stevens

4. Data Networks, Bertsekas-Gallager

5. An Engineering Approach to Computer Networking, S. Keshav
